The award-winning Choisya x dewitteana 'Aztec Pearl' was bred in 1982 from a cross between Choisya ternata and Choisya dumosa var. arizonica. The cultivar was bred by Peter Moore for Hillier nurseries, located in Hampshire in the United Kingdom. It is a broadleaf evergreen shrub that will reach a height of 8' tall.

Choisya ternata is a species of flowering plant in the family Rutaceae, [1] known as Mexican orange blossom or Mexican orange . Description Choisya ternata is an evergreen shrub, growing up to 3 m (10 ft) in height. Its leaves have three leaflets (hence ternata) and are aromatic, releasing a smell reminiscent of basil when crushed. [2]

Family: Rutaceae Genus: Choisya Type: Broadleaf Native to (or naturalized in) Oregon: No Broadleaf evergreen shrub, 5-8 ft (1.5-2.4 m), dense and rounded. Leaves opposite, palmately compound, 3 leaflets ( ternata = in threes), each 2.5-7.5 cm long, glossy, sessile, rounded, lustrous green, when crushed they emit a pungent odor.

Mexican orange 'Aztec Pearl'. A small evergreen shrub of open rounded habit, with bright green leaves composed of 3-5 slender leaflets. Flowers to 3cm in width, fragrant, white, tinged pink in bud, in small clusters in late spring, and again in autumn.

Aztec Pearl Choisya Pronunciation: CHOIZ-e-a Family: Rutaceae Genus: Choisya Type: Broadleaf Native to (or naturalized in) Oregon: No Evergreen shrub, 8 ft (2.4 m) tall and wide. Leaves opposite, palmately compound, 3-5 narrow, 8 cm long leaflets, bright green, aromatic.
